Pereval Besmoynok Pervyy
Pereval Besmoynok Pervyy is a pass in Naryn Region, Kyrgyzstan and has an elevation of 3,865 metres.Places of Interest

Tash Rabat

Tash Rabat is a well-preserved 10th- or 15th-century stone caravanserai in At-Bashy District, Naryn Province, Kyrgyzstan, located at an altitude of 3,200 metres.
